I would not risk with registration anyway. We are registered with FMS to issue invites for business visas for our partners and we have had regular checks of documentation during the last year, including checks of the registration address. It may take some time to link FSB and FMS databases, and this will happen eventually. Btw, big hotels do registration electronically already and this take minutes. But, penalties may be heavy even for the inviting company, tens and hundreds of thousands of rubles, so I insist that my partners do get registered. Anyway the phrase to do the registration is mandatory in our visa invite application and we all have to obey ;)
